MXNet,全称Apache MXNet,是一款由Apache软件基金会支持的开源深度学习框架。它以其高性能、灵活性以及易用性而受到广大开发者的青睐。对于深度学习初学者来说,掌握MXNet是迈向人工智能领域的重要一步。本文将带你轻松上手MXNet,从一键下载到安装,让你快速入门。
一、了解MXNet
在开始安装之前,让我们先了解一下MXNet的一些基本特点:
- 高性能:MXNet能够在多种硬件平台上运行,包括CPU、GPU和移动设备。
- 灵活:支持多种编程语言,包括Python、R、Java、C++和Go。
- 易于扩展:用户可以根据需求自定义模块,实现个性化的深度学习解决方案。
二、环境准备
在安装MXNet之前,确保你的计算机满足以下条件:
- 操作系统:Windows、macOS或Linux。
- 编程语言:Python 3.x。
- 包管理器:pip。
三、一键下载与安装
以下是在不同操作系统上一键下载和安装MXNet的步骤:
Windows系统
- 打开命令行工具(cmd)。
- 输入以下命令:
pip install mxnet
- 安装过程中可能会提示你下载额外的包,根据提示进行操作。
- 安装完成后,可以通过以下命令检查MXNet版本:
mxnet.__version__
macOS和Linux系统
- 打开终端。
- 对于Python 3.x,使用以下命令:
pip3 install mxnet
- 对于Python 2.x,使用以下命令:
pip install mxnet
- 安装完成后,使用相同的方法检查MXNet版本。
四、配置环境变量(可选)
在某些情况下,你可能需要将MXNet的Python包路径添加到环境变量中,以便在任何地方都可以使用MXNet。
Windows系统
- 右键点击“此电脑”或“我的电脑”,选择“属性”。
- 点击“高级系统设置”。
- 在“系统属性”窗口中,点击“环境变量”。
- 在“系统变量”下,找到Path变量,点击“编辑”。
- 在Path变量的值中,添加以下路径(以英文分号分隔):
;C:\path\to\mxnet\python\lib\site-packages
- 点击“确定”保存更改。
macOS和Linux系统
- 打开终端。
- 使用以下命令编辑.bashrc文件:
nano ~/.bashrc
- 在文件的末尾添加以下行:
export PATH=$PATH:/path/to/mxnet/python/lib/site-packages
- 保存并关闭文件。
- 在终端中运行以下命令使更改生效:
source ~/.bashrc
五、验证安装
安装完成后,可以通过以下Python代码验证MXNet是否已正确安装:
import mxnet as mx
print(mx.__version__)
如果输出MXNet的版本号,则表示MXNet已成功安装。
六、总结
通过本文的步骤,你已成功安装了MXNet。接下来,你可以开始学习如何在MXNet中进行深度学习实践。祝你在AI领域取得更大的成就!
